...人想象的理想状态是,你,用户,拥有一个钱包(想想 Metamask,但可用性更好),允许你连接到任何链上的任何 dapp 并立即进行交易。无需配置底层网络。无需将资金桥接到正确的链。无需考虑 gas 代币。 然而,一个主要的障...
...下几样东西: **加密钱包:** 一个兼容的加密钱包,如 MetaMask 或 Rabby,已安装并在 Berachain 网络中配置。你将代币存储在其中,并能够与 Berachain 的 dApp 互动。 > 在我们的文章 ["选择你的 Berachain 钱包"](https://learnblockchain.cn/articl...
...猜测 ABI 编码数据类型的 TypeScript 库 * 用 VanillaJS 通过 MetaMask与合约交互[指南](https://codingwithmanny.medium.com/use-vanillajs-to-connect-to-metamask-read-from-a-contract-write-to-a-contract-7a3d213ac438) * [Grim-reaper](https://github.com/massun-onibakuchi/grim-reaper...
... 智能合约钱包,社交恢复 | 私钥丢失、批量操作 | ✅ MetaMask/Coinbase已支持 | | **ERC-1271** | Contract Signature | 合约钱包签名验证 | Gnosis Safe交互 | ✅ 多签/智能钱包基石 | | **ERC-5267** | EIP-712 Discovery | 链上发现类型定...
...ection: [ "$EMBARK", "$WEB3", // 使用浏览器注入的web3, 如MetaMask等 "ws://localhost:8546", "http://localhost:8545" ], ``` `$EMBARK` : 是Embark在DApp和节点之前实现的一个代理,使用`$EMBARK`有几个好处: 1. 可以在`config/blockchain.js` 配置于DA...
... ### 准备工作 - 以太坊钱包,本文中采用 “浏览器 + MetaMask 插件钱包” 的组合,您也可以直接使用诸如 imToken 的手机钱包 - 一点点 Gas 费 ### 查询并注册 在 Chrome 中打开子域名注册工具 [ENSNow](https://now.ensuser.com/) ,并连...
...?** **1.解锁钱包 ** 当你使用dapp时,需要输入密码解锁metamask钱包是安全的。 **2.切换网络 ** 例如你当前是在Etherum Main network网络,Dapp需要切换到BSC 网络这个操作是安全的。 **3.连接钱包 ** 对方需要连接到你的Dapp钱包,...
... 使用 POW 的 [Goerli ETH 水龙头](https://goerli-faucet.pk910.de/) * MetaMask Snaps [教程](https://github.com/Montoya/gas-fee-snap#readme) * 用 Shamir 的秘密分享[分享助记词](https://medium.com/nethermind-eth/using-shamirs-secret-sharing-to-share-mnemonics-c40429835117) ## 安...
...; candidatesSelect.empty(); for (var i = 1; i 如何设置MetaMask 可阅读[开发、部署第一个去中心化应用](https://learnblockchain.cn/2018/01/12/first-dapp/)。 本文为保持主干清晰,代码有删减, 完整代码请订阅[小专栏](https://xiaozhuanlan....
...境的入口,因为最终我们会将发布的NFT添加到电子钱包(MetaMask)中,这样我们需要一个公网地址和域名,以及一张证书。但最重要的是我们需要保护虚拟机不被攻击,所以我又添加了API Management和Application Gateway两个云服务。以下...
...你正在使用remix,所以继续,通过*Injected Web3*环境连接到metamask钱包,并部署合约,指定自己的挑战地址来分配给自己的界面。 现在,在将值输入为1的情况下,继续调用guess函数。 我已经添加了更多的函数: * `getBalance()` *...
...加入`\x19Ethereum Signed Message:\n32`。 > > 如下这两种方法和metamask的签名结果一样。 > > 但是如下这里个并不是按照如下的计算方式: > > ```solidity > bytes memory prefix = "\x19Ethereum Signed Message:\n32"; > bytes32 result = keccak256(a...